A key highlight this year is our ABC Green Home 5.0 TerraVerde, a high-performance, American Buildable Certified demonstration home. TerraVerde will debut as a fully immersive virtual home this Fall, allowing home buyers, builders, designers and manufacturers to explore its advanced energy, resilience and sustainable features from anywhere. A grand opening in Temecula is planned for Fall 2027, turning TerraVerde into a real-world classroom for the building industry. Over a 24-month cycle, the project will document and showcase builder and consumer interest in hardened, resilient and sustainable high-performance home building, providing a blueprint for future developments.
